How to Stop the Thought Loops That Block Meaning

To move forward, you need more than motivation—you need tools for your inner dialogue. One practical method is learning to recognize negative thought triggers, such as comparisons, uncertainty, or conversations that leave you feeling exposed. Once you can spot the trigger, you can interrupt the pattern instead of automatically believing every thought that appears. This shift is essential for maintaining momentum when circumstances feel challenging.

Another step is transforming unhelpful statements into balanced, purposeful questions. For example, rather than asking, “Why am I like this?” you can ask, “What do I need right now to take the next right step?” This reframing reduces self-blame and increases problem-solving. Coaching helps you practice these questions until they become a default response, so your mind supports your goals instead of sabotaging them. Over time, you build emotional resilience that makes it easier to stay present, evaluate options calmly, and choose actions that match your values.
